Step-by-Step Application Guide

Using CHROMIUS™ is straightforward. Follow these steps for the best results:

  1. Prepare the Surface: Clean the area thoroughly to remove dust, grease, or old paint.
  2. Shake Well: Before applying, shake the can for about 2 minutes to ensure even distribution.
  3. Test Spray: Conduct a test spray on a scrap surface to familiarize yourself with the spray pattern.
  4. Apply Evenly: Hold the can 15-30 cm away from the surface and apply in smooth, sweeping motions.
  5. Allow to Dry: Let the paint dry completely before handling or applying additional coats.

FAQs

Can CHROMIUS™ be used on plastic surfaces?

Yes, CHROMIUS™ can be applied to plastic surfaces after proper preparation.

How long does CHROMIUS™ take to dry?

CHROMIUS™ typically dries to the touch within 30 minutes but allows for full curing in 24 hours.

Is CHROMIUS™ safe for indoor use?

Yes, CHROMIUS™ is safe for indoor use, but ensure proper ventilation during application.
